Blink 182: Tom DeLonge (guitar, vocals); Mark Hopper (bass, vocals); Scott Raynor (drums).
Additional personnel: Mark Trombino (piano, keyboards); Scott Russo.
Recorded at Big Fish Studios, Encinitas, California.
Following the release of their 1996 debut CHESHIRE CAT, Blink 182 returns with a satisfactory sophomore effort. Clearly influenced by the likes of Green Day and Weezer, Blink 182 provides fast, aggressive punk that is also melodic and fun. The trio's lyrics are filled with the angst and alienation that teens can relate to, while injecting humor also. "A New Hope" is an ode to Princess Leia and the Star Wars gang, while "Waggy" is a word bassist Mark Hoppus came up with while belching. Hard-core fans of the band will not be disappointed, as "Degenerate" is a re-recording from their demo tape, and "Lemmings" is from a split 7". All the songs on the record are catchy and infectious and hit single potential abounds. The musicianship is also there, as the chops are tight and worthy of comparison to any great punk band. Overall, DUDE RANCH proves the continued viability of punk-pop in the late '90s.
